South Mountain Aviation Soars to Regional Dominance in Small Jet Maintenance
The one-year-old company has quickly become the Mid-Atlantic's trusted aviation service, fulfilling the need for jet maintenance.
Jet maintenance and repairs are not widely offered in the Mid-Atlantic, causing corporate flight departments and small jet owners to travel farther and pay a higher cost for run-of-the-mill service. Over the past year, South Mountain Aviation has built a loyal customer base, with several regional and national industry giants seeking repeat service. The company's positive reputation can largely be attributed to exemplary, personal service and flexibility. It has increased its staff from 2 to 6 members and plans to double by the end of 2025, opening up more opportunities to expand services and maintain its standard of quality and timeliness. The entire staff has significant industry experience and expertise from on-the-job and factory training from Textron Aviation, Williams International and Cirrus Aircraft, among others.

About South Mountain Aviation
South Mountain Aviation, founded in 2024, is the go to aircraft maintenance and avionics company in the Mid-Atlantic. South Mountain Aviation services and maintains Gulfstreams, Globals, and Hawkers and Citation Jets. The company also sells, installs, maintains and repairs avionics systems for general aviation aircraft, including business jets, twin turboprops and single-engine piston airplanes.
